本文实例为大家分享了C++使用模板类实现链式栈的具体代码,供大家参考,具体内容如下 一、实现程序: 1.Stack.h #ifndef Stack_h #define Stack_h template class Stack { public: Stack(){}; // 构造函数 void Push(const T x); // 新元素进栈 bool Pop(); // 栈顶元素出栈 virtual bool getTop(T &x) const = 0; // 读取栈顶元素,由x返回 virtual bool isEmpty() const = 0
2021-12-28 20:31:50 48KB 模板 模板类
1
线性表的类型定义 线性表的类型实现(包括顺序印象和链式印象)
2021-12-28 14:32:52 2.27MB 线性表 顺序印象 链式印象
1
编号为1-52张牌,正面向上,从第2张开始,以2为基数,是2的倍数的牌翻一次,直到最后一张牌;然后,从第3张开始,以3为基数,是3的倍数的牌翻一次,直到最后一张牌;然后…从第4张开始,以4为基数,是4的倍数的牌翻一次, 直到最后一张牌;...再依次5的倍数的牌翻一次,6的,7的 直到以52为基数的翻过 输出:这时正面向上的牌有哪些?
2021-12-21 10:14:45 63KB 纸牌游戏 链式存储结构 数据结构
1
1.需求分析 ①.问题描述 给出一组数据,按照最低位优先的方法完成基数排序。多关键码排序按照从最主位关键码到最次位或从最次位到最主位关键码的顺序逐次排序。
2021-12-19 19:45:47 49KB 链式基数排序算法
1
NULL 博文链接:https://canlynet.iteye.com/blog/605687
2021-12-14 14:31:27 3KB 源码 工具
1
一、 实验目的 1、 掌握线性表的结构特点。 2、 掌握线性表的基本操作:初始化,插入,删除,查找,判空,求线性表长度等运算在顺序存储结构和链式存储结构上的实现。 3、 通过本章实验帮助学生加深对C语言的使用(特别是函数的参数调用、指针类型的应用)。 二、 实验要求 1、 选择何时的存储方式实现线性表。其中,必须实现的线性表基本操作为:InitList、 ClearList、ListEmpty、ListLength、GetElem、PriorElem、ListInsert、ListDelete这8个基本操作,其余的可以选作。 2、 所写源代码编程风格良好,有详细注释。 3、 程序运行界面良好,使用菜单实现每个基本操作。 4、 实验报告书写规范。
2021-12-12 16:56:56 5KB 线性表运算
1
主要介绍了C语言中数据结构之链式基数排序的相关资料,希望通过本文能帮助到大家,需要的朋友可以参考下
1
1.对给定二叉树用链式链式存储结构;利用队列与栈对二叉树进行运算。 2.按层次输出所有结点。 3.输出所有叶子结点。 4.将所有左右子树值交换。
2021-12-09 13:53:53 2KB c++ 二叉树 遍历 叶子
1
利用java写了两个案例是关于二叉树和平衡树的分别为数组的和链式的。 功能: 1.三种历遍方式的输出。 2.平衡树的重构。 3.节点的添加以及删除。 4.平均查找长度的计算。
2021-12-06 20:56:46 77KB java 二叉树 平衡树 平均查找长度
1
对Elasticsearch-PHP进行查询语句封装 可实现链式调用 方便 es查询
2021-12-03 09:17:42 5KB PHP开发-搜索引擎
1